Booked with the impression there was a hot tub on site. Arrived to discover it was not operational. Very little water pressure for showers. Toilet falling off the base. Old coffee left in coffee maker. Curtain rods breaking off wall. Floorboards were breaking. Although the location was good for a group ski weekend, this place could use some repairs and general upkeep.

The hot tub is not available in the winter and this was not what the listing said. Based on the hosts message (which came in AFTER the date which we could get a refund) it sounds like the hot tub is always unavailable in the winter but this was not how the listing was advertised. This is misrepresentation. Then, we arrived to the property to find there was no running water, which it seems the host knew about based on a review from Jan 2026. This was not dealt with for a full 24 hours from our arrival, after asking the host to deal with it multiple times. We were unable to shower & drink water for the first 2 full days & nights. Because even when the water was back on, it ran black for over 12 hours. Meaning we could not shower until our third day there. Being that we were on a ski trip, not having a hot tub or working shower or drinking water was absolutely unacceptable. A few other things to mention are that some basic essentials were missing: cooking oil, sugar and the coffee maker would only work 1 out of 4 days. The towels provided were small & only 1 per person. There is not enough seating in the living room for a 10 person chalet. The cost we paid for this is astronomical compared to the experience we were provided. We appreciate that the host fixed the water but it’s very disappointing that it took a full 24 hours and us reaching out multiple times for this to be actioned.
